Greetings, folks.

Been a lurker for a bit and finally made an account to join in on the fun conversations. I have a new 21 3.0 premium and have read through every audio thread on this forum, other sites, and youtube :cool:

I have done the Tadda fix and it certainly helped with the low end, but ultimately I would like to do a bit more with it. I visited my sound shop today and he is putting together a few quotes for me, but I want to be armed with as much info as possible to ensure I am not just throwing money away.

My simplified thoughts are:
The front speakers sound pretty decent (imo) after quite a bit of EQ tuning, etc. I know the shop is going to quote me for a full replacement across the board, and also just a "low end" fix. For the sake of costs, I am leaning towards a low-end fix and this is where I would love some opinions from you fellas.

Ideally I would like to keep the factory 8's where they are and use them as mid-bass options. I'd be adding a 10 inch sub to the system with an amp and dsp to clean up the sound a bit. Regarding the mid-bass (factory 8s), can the amp/dsp combo also be attached to those to clean up the sound a bit? The mid bass tends to fall off as I approach 65% volume levels and I wasn't sure if this was something I could clean up.

To dsp/amp the 8"s you'll need to disconnect from factory amp and connect to the new amp, can't do both. Your installer planning on deleting the factory amp or just high-level inputting the signals to the new amp?
